In this video, we delve into the fascinating world of large language models (LLMs) and their practical applications, especially in home automation and personal productivity. We explore how AI can augment our daily routines by automating tasks like managing air quality, controlling lighting, and even assisting in the development of software. Our discussion highlights the potential of running these models locally to enhance privacy and responsiveness, emphasizing that with the right hardware—such as powerful GPUs or specialized chips—you can operate complex AI systems right within your own home 🌐.
We also address common misconceptions about AI and LLMs, clarifying that these models do not possess true understanding but instead predict the next most probable words based on extensive training data. This prediction capability enables impressive outputs, but it also introduces risks like hallucinations, where the AI confidently states false information (e.g., suggesting WD-40 as a pizza topping). Therefore, knowing how these systems work is crucial for leveraging their strengths and avoiding pitfalls. We discuss how integrating retrieval systems and external databases can significantly improve the accuracy and reliability of AI responses.
Furthermore, we share insights into running AI models locally on various hardware setups, from high-end PCs with GPUs to compact devices like the Jetson Nano. Running models locally ensures better data privacy and reduces dependency on internet connectivity. We reflect on the versatility of AI for managing multiple home automation tasks simultaneously—such as listening for voice commands, analyzing sensor data, and generating text—highlighting its role as a collaborative assistant rather than a complete replacer. Lastly, we touch on the practical use cases, including summarizing links with tools like Carep, generating outlines for content creation, and the importance of combining AI with context-aware sensors for smarter home automation 🏡.
🔗 Gear Up with Our Top Tips:
Experiment with open-source LLM frameworks like Olama to understand their capabilities and limitations.
Use ret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) to enhance accuracy when deploying local AI models.
Leverage AI to automate routine tasks like managing air quality, lighting, or content organization in your home.
Choose hardware wisely—powerful GPUs or dedicated chips like Nvidia Jetson for local model deployment accelerate AI performance.
